How does a Remote Software Safety Engineer typically collaborate with cross-functional teams while working offsite?

As a Remote Software Safety Engineer, collaboration with cross-functional teams such as hardware engineers, quality assurance, and project managers is mainly achieved through virtual meetings, shared documentation, and dedicated communication platforms. Frequent coordination is essential to review designs, discuss safety requirements, and address potential hazards in the software development process. Effective communication and proactive participation in team discussions help ensure that safety standards are maintained, even when working remotely. Many organizations also utilize agile methodologies to facilitate structured interactions and keep everyone aligned on project goals.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Remote Software Safety Engineer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Remote Software Safety Engineer, you need a solid background in computer science or engineering, experience with safety-critical systems, and knowledge of relevant safety standards (such as ISO 26262 or IEC 61508). Familiarity with safety analysis tools, version control systems, and requirements management software is typically required, along with certifications like Certified Functional Safety Expert (CFSE) being advantageous. Excellent problem-solving, communication, and self-motivation skills are crucial for collaborating effectively and maintaining high standards while working remotely. These skills and qualifications ensure the development and maintenance of reliable, compliant, and secure software in environments where safety is paramount.

What is a Remote Software Safety Engineer?

A Remote Software Safety Engineer is a professional who works from a remote location to ensure that software systems, especially those used in safety-critical industries like automotive, aerospace, or healthcare, operate safely and reliably. Their responsibilities include identifying potential hazards, conducting risk assessments, developing safety requirements, and ensuring compliance with relevant safety standards. They collaborate with engineering teams, perform software verification and validation, and often use specialized tools to detect and mitigate software risks. Working remotely, they leverage digital communication and project management tools to stay connected and effective. This role is essential in preventing software failures that could lead to accidents or harm.

This position is listed on behalf of a partner company, who manages all applications and next steps. Our partner is looking for a Senior Software Engineer (Go) - AI Resilience & Security Enhancements (Contract) based in Netherlands.

As a Senior Software Engineer (Go), you will contribute to high-impact initiatives focused on strengthening the security, resilience, and reliability of a modern cloud-native platform. In this contract role, you'll design and deliver production-ready capabilities that enhance system security while supporting the evolution of AI governance, software supply chain protection, and platform resilience. Working within a fully remote, collaborative engineering environment, you'll partner with software engineers, platform specialists, and security experts to build scalable solutions that integrate seamlessly into the software development lifecycle. This is an excellent opportunity to solve complex technical challenges using modern cloud technologies while making a lasting impact on mission-critical infrastructure.

Accountabilities
  • Design, develop, and deliver secure, scalable software solutions using Go within a distributed, cloud-native architecture.
  • Build and enhance platform capabilities focused on API security, cryptographic controls, AI governance, software supply chain security, and automated security tooling.
  • Collaborate closely with engineering, platform, and security teams to implement resilient solutions that improve the security posture of production systems.
  • Contribute to the design and maintenance of distributed systems, ensuring high performance, reliability, and operational resilience.
  • Develop production-ready services that integrate with modern cloud infrastructure, containerized environments, and CI/CD pipelines.
  • Apply software engineering best practices, including clean code principles, automated testing, pair programming, and continuous delivery methodologies.
  • Take ownership of technical initiatives from design through deployment, supporting successful production releases and long-term maintainability.
  • Share technical knowledge and contribute to a collaborative engineering culture focused on continuous improvement and innovation.
Requirements
  • Strong professional experience developing software with Go, alongside a pragmatic approach to selecting the most appropriate technologies.
  • Proven expertise designing and building distributed systems within cloud-native environments.
  • Experience working with cloud platforms such as AWS, Azure, or Google Cloud Platform, as well as Kubernetes and containerized microservices.
  • Solid understanding of software security concepts, including API security, cryptography, AI governance, secure software supply chains, or related security engineering practices.
  • Experience with infrastructure automation, CI/CD pipelines, and DevSecOps or SecDevOps methodologies.
  • Familiarity with technologies such as Terraform, GitHub, Elasticsearch, Vault, NATS JetStream, CockroachDB, Prometheus, Flux, Pact.io, or similar modern engineering tools.
  • Strong commitment to software engineering best practices, including test-driven development (TDD), behavior-driven development (BDD), code quality, and maintainability.
  • Excellent communication and collaboration skills with the ability to work effectively in distributed, remote-first teams.
  • Ability to independently own technical projects from implementation through production deployment and operational support.
